Here are some ideas from Forbes about healthy brain habits.  If you increase your good habits little by little you could be dancing in the morning.  Even if you have marginal gains these small daily tweaks can add up to boost energy and foster good internal conditions for optimal brain functions.  I can get on board with this.
The research points to getting 7 to 8 hours of sleep a night.  If you consistently have a sleep deficit this will deplete the cognitive resources.  Oversleeping, more than 9 hours can make you lethargic, tends towards increased obesity and other cardiac risks.  Oh! my heart.  Use a sleep diary, because if your getting too much or too little it is a good thing to know.  Plus you can write down all of the worries that keep you awake.
Next get up and stretch for 5 to 20 minutes.  This helps the blood flow to the body and the brain.  This can also increase your working memory and inhibitory control.
This next part is something that I know about but have a hard time implementing.  Drink some green tea or tumeric or lemon water or apple cider vinegar water instead of coffee (double espresso anyone.
